> > We had three questions.
> > 
> > Q1) When we executed the next command, the contents of the CLI file are 
> displayed in the form that ""(double quatation) disappeared.
> > 
> > [root@snmp1 ~]# crm configure show
> > (snip)
> > primitive prmDummy1 ocf:pacemaker:Dummy \
> > op start interval=0s timeout=300s on-fail=restart \
> > op monitor interval=10s timeout=60s on-fail=restart \
> > op stop interval=0s timeout=300s on-fail=block
> > primitive prmDummy2 Dummy \
> > op start interval=0s timeout=300s on-fail=restart \
> > op monitor interval=10s timeout=60s on-fail=restart \
> > op stop interval=0s timeout=300s on-fail=block
> > (snip)
> > 
> > When we used Pacemaker1.0, results seem to be different.
> > Are these specifications of new crm command?
> > 
> 
> Yes, this is the new CLI syntax for crmsh. Where possible, crmsh now
> tries to avoid adding the double quotation marks.
> 
> 
> > Q2) When we executed the next command, ocf:heartbeat is not displayed.
> > 
> > (snip)
> > [root@snmp1 ~]# crm configure show
> > (snip)
> > primitive prmDummy2 Dummy \
> > op start interval=0s timeout=300s on-fail=restart \
> > op monitor interval=10s timeout=60s on-fail=restart \
> > op stop interval=0s timeout=300s on-fail=block
> > (snip)
> > 
> > When we used Pacemaker1.0, results seem to be different.
> > Are these specifications of new crm command?
> > 
> 
> Yes, this is also a new feature in crmsh. When using agents from
> ocf:heartbeat:, crmsh does not display the prefix part.
> 
> > Q3) We used the editing feature in the next procedure, but it is not 
> changed.
> > Is a procedure of our editing wrong?
> 
> Unfortunately, this is a bug in pacemaker, fixed very recently:
> 
> https://github.com/ClusterLabs/pacemaker/pull/613
> 
> With your version of crmsh, it is possible to work around this issue by
> using the interactive shell to modify:
> 
> crm configure
> edit
> commit replace
> 
> Using the "commit replace" command circumvents the buggy CIB patching
> feature and uses cibadmin to update the CIB.
